Output fbaa629c7ab7c2f5354b339b1cad2ee4ff25c2108171525c11e316fb9e0ae86f:0

value
489994192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d9d015137ff2df80d711f821b5787c23ada23fa OP_EQUAL
address
3LSCXn4bkS7PcYqDqDJsyvF1P7SB6UB2gC
transaction
fbaa629c7ab7c2f5354b339b1cad2ee4ff25c2108171525c11e316fb9e0ae86f